stringFromCLSID 函式 (combaseapi.h)

將 CLSID 轉換成可列印字元的字串。 不同的 CLSID 一律會轉換成不同的字串。

語法

HRESULT StringFromCLSID(
  [in]  REFCLSID rclsid,
  [out] LPOLESTR *lplpsz
);

參數

[in] rclsid

要轉換的 CLSID。

[out] lplpsz

接收所產生字串指標的指標變數位址。 表示 rclsid 的字串包含括住大括弧。

傳回值

此函式可以傳回標準傳回值E_OUTOFMEMORY和S_OK。

備註

StringFromCLSID 會呼叫 StringFromGUID2 函式,將全域唯一標識符 (GUID) 轉換成可列印字元的字串。

呼叫端負責藉由呼叫 CoTaskMemFree 函式釋放為字串配置的記憶體。

規格需求

需求
最低支援的用戶端 Windows 2000 專業版 [傳統型應用程式 |UWP 應用程式]
最低支援的伺服器 Windows 2000 Server [傳統型應用程式 |UWP 應用程式]
目標平台 Windows
標頭 combaseapi.h (包含 Objbase.h)
程式庫 Ole32.lib
Dll Ole32.dll

另請參閱

CLSIDFromString

StringFromGUID2